DOZENS of employers looking to recruit young talent will be at the Bradford District Apprenticeship Event later this month.
Aimed at Year 10 and 11 school pupils, their parents and teachers, the event is being held at Bradford City Football Club’s stadium on Thursday, November 22 from noon to 7pm.
Visitors will get the chance to find out all about apprenticeships and what opportunities are available to teenagers when they finish school.
Leeds Bradford Airport, the NHS, Sky TV, PWC, Bradford Council, Yorkshire Building Society and Skipton Building Society are among the businesses who will be there.
